Output ddd38ecdd1de92e8d97626f1bdc1f30ca728f7ed4b34a4942d01f686be69d7a8:0

value
255659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68152d63d9109661ac02624258830ae97db54c54 OP_EQUAL
address
3BBMZvFwbs5iDhCbmKVFyGs4rJ7JYyt5B9
transaction
ddd38ecdd1de92e8d97626f1bdc1f30ca728f7ed4b34a4942d01f686be69d7a8
spent
true